What is Cat Skiing?

Cat skiing involves using a snowcat, a large vehicle designed for snowy terrain, to take skiers to remote areas with fresh, deep snow. Unlike regular ski lifts, snowcats give you access to untouched powder, making the experience exciting and special.

Why Cat Skiing in BC is Special

  1. Reliable Snowfall: BC is known for its consistent snowfall, even with climate changes. This makes it one of the best places for skiing in deep powder.

  2. Beautiful Landscapes: The mountains and forests in BC provide stunning views. Cat skiing takes you to some of the most beautiful and untouched parts of the region.

  3. Variety of Terrain: BC offers a wide range of terrain, from gentle slopes to challenging runs, suitable for all levels of skiers.

  4. Less Crowded: Cat skiing takes you away from the busy resort slopes, allowing you to enjoy a more peaceful and private skiing experience.

Tips for Enjoying BC Cat Skiing

  1. Check Weather Reports: Before heading out, look at the latest weather forecasts and snow conditions to ensure a great skiing experience.

  2. Dress Appropriately: Wear layers and waterproof clothing to stay warm and dry. Conditions can change quickly in the mountains.

  3. Use Suitable Gear: Use skis that are designed for powder to help you glide smoothly through the deep snow.

  4. Book in Advance: Cat skiing is popular, so make sure to book your trip early to secure your spot.

  5. Stay Safe: Always follow safety guidelines and listen to your guides. They know the terrain and can ensure you have a safe and enjoyable experience.
